CDC Warns About Rising Bacterial Meningitis Infections in 2024
There have already been more than 140 cases of bacterial meningitis reported in 2024, exceeding the amount reported this time last year.

The meningococcal disease outbreak has been linked to at least seven deaths, the CDC warns.
